Troubleshooting Guide
Installation
I followed the instructions, but I still can't install Sidestore.
Mac Instructions
- Trust Device: After connecting your iOS device to your Mac, ensure you have said “Trust” on both your Mac and iOS device. You can verify this by:
- Opening Finder (macOS 10.15 Catalina or later) or iTunes (macOS 10.14 Mojave and earlier).
- Disconnect and reconnect your phone to your mac and check if a dialog box appears asking if you want to trust the device.
- Use Another Apple ID: Try using another Apple ID. If needed, you can create a new Apple ID specifically for Sidestore for free.
Windows Instructions
- Trust Device: After connecting your iOS device to your Windows computer, ensure you have said “Trust” on both your computer and iOS device. You can verify this by:
- Opening iTunes and checking if a dialog box appears asking if you want to trust the device.
- Run AltServer as Administrator: Right-click on AltServer and select “Run as Administrator” to ensure proper permissions.
- Use Another Apple ID: Try using another Apple ID. If needed, you can create a new Apple ID specifically for Sidestore for free.
- Non-Microsoft Store Version of iTunes and iCloud:
- If you installed iTunes or iCloud from the Microsoft Store, you’ll need to uninstall them.
- Download and install the non-Microsoft Store versions of iTunes and iCloud using the following links:
Sign-In Issues
Sidestore Freezing or Displaying an Error Code During Sign-In
If you encounter freezing or error codes while attempting to sign in to Sidestore, there could be several potential causes. Follow these steps to resolve the issue:
-
Change the Anisette Server: The most common solution is to switch to a different Anisette server. Anisette servers may occasionally experience downtime. Switching to an alternative server typically resolves the issue. Do this:
- Open Sidestore settings.
- Scroll down to the "Anisette Server" option.
- Select a different server from the list.
- You might need to try a few servers from the list and find which works best for you.
-
Host Your Own Anisette Server: If you prefer, you can set up your own Anisette server. Detailed instructions for hosting an Anisette server are available in the official documentation and can he found here.
Verification Code Not Received When Signing In with Apple ID
Another common issue during sign-in is not receiving a verification code when using your Apple ID with Sidestore. This can be resolved by following these steps:
For iOS versions below 18.1:
- Open the "Settings" app.
- Tap on your name at the top of the screen.
- Navigate to "Sign-In and Security."
- Select "Two-Factor Authentication."
- Choose "Get Verification Code."
For iOS versions 18.1 and above:
- Visit iCloud on a web browser.
- Click "Sign In."
- When prompted, you will see two options: "Sign In" and "Use Different Apple Account."
- Select the bottom option, "Use Different Apple Account."
- Enter your Apple ID and password.
- Apple will send you a verification code.
- Use this code in Sidestore to complete the sign-in process.
Can't Refresh or Install Apps
Resolving No Wi-Fi or VPN Error
- Disable your cellular data / connect to a stable Wi-Fi network.
- Ensure that Apple domains, and the domain for your anisette server, are not restricted. Check the following:
- Turn off any DNS blocking domains such as
oscp.apple.com
- Disconnect from school/work Wi-Fi, try connecting to a restriction-free network.
- Turn off any DNS blocking domains such as
- Verify VPN is connected in the WireGuard app.
- Turn off, then turn back on WireGuard, and wait a few seconds in SideStore before trying to refresh.
- Create a brand new pairing file.
- If none of the above worked it is very likely that the pairing file is corrupted. You can reference the documentation on how to create a new pairing file here.
- After creating a new pairing file, go to Sidestore settings and press "Reset pairing file", then choose the new pairing file you just created.
Cannot Choose Pairing File
If you are unable to select a pairing file in Sidestore, follow these steps to resolve the issue:
- Check File Extension: Make sure your pairing file's extension ends with
.mobiledevicepairing
or.plist
. If it doesn't, double-check to see if you had zipped your pairing file before sending it to your phone. Failing to do so may lead to the file being corrupted during transport. - Move Pairing File: If you are unable to select the pairing file from within the app, rename the file to
ALTPairingFile.mobiledevicepairing
and try moving the pairing file to the root directory of the SideStore folder in the Files app in "On My iPhone/iPad". - Certificate Signing: When signing Sidestore with a certificate, you won't be able to select the pairing file from within the app. You can try the fix mentioned above. If you do not see the Sidestore folder in the Files app, connect your phone to your computer, and you can drag and drop the pairing file to the files of the Sidestore app. Ensure to change it to the name mentioned above.
AltServer
AltStore says “Could not find AltServer” when trying to sideload or refresh apps.
AltServer must be running on a computer connected to the same Wi-Fi as AltStore in order to sideload or refresh apps. If AltServer is running on the same Wi-Fi network as AltStore and you're still receiving this error, try the following:
- Are you on public/work/school Wi-Fi? If so, your Wi-Fi might be preventing devices from discovering each other. Try connecting your computer to your phone’s hotspot and trying again. (If you're using an iPad, make sure it's connected to your hotspot as well.)
- Have you said “Trust” on both your Mac and iOS device after connecting your device to your Mac? You can check by Finder (macOS 10.15 Catalina or later) or iTunes (macOS 10.14 Mojave and earlier) and seeing if a dialog box pops up asking if you want to trust your phone.
- (Windows) Your firewall might be blocking incoming network connections to AltServer. You must enable network access for AltServer in your firewall settings for it to receive refreshed apps from AltStore.
- (Windows) Did you install iTunes or iCloud from the Microsoft Store? If so, you’ll need to uninstall them and download the latest versions directly from Apple.
- Finally, try plugging your iPhone or iPad into your computer. This should fix all connectivity problems, but does mean AltStore may not be able to automatically refresh apps for you in the background over Wi-Fi.
I’m unable to change my network settings to allow devices to communicate with each other (such as on school/work/public Wi-Fi).
You can always sideload and refresh apps without Wi-Fi by plugging your iPhone or iPad into your computer. However, this means AltStore may not be able to refresh apps for you in the background over Wi-Fi.
AltJIT
AltServer says “JIT could not be enabled for [App]".
This could happen for a number of reasons. If you’re experiencing this issue, please check the following:
- Make sure the app you are trying to enable JIT for is running in the foreground on your device.
- Are you on public/work/school Wi-Fi? If so, your Wi-Fi might be preventing devices from discovering each other. Try connecting your computer to your phone’s hotspot and trying again. (If you're using an iPad, make sure it's connected to your hotspot as well.)
- Have you said “Trust” on both your Mac and iOS device after connecting your device to your Mac? You can check by Finder (macOS 10.15 Catalina or later) or iTunes (macOS 10.14 Mojave and earlier) and seeing if a dialog box pops up asking if you want to trust your phone.
- (Windows) Firewall might be blocking incoming network connections to AltServer. You must enable network access for AltServer in your firewall settings for it to receive refreshed apps from AltStore.
- (Windows) Did you install iTunes or iCloud from the Microsoft Store? If so, you’ll need to uninstall them and download the latest versions directly from Apple.
- You may need to make sure iTunes and iCloud are running on your computer as well.
- Finally, try plugging your iPhone or iPad into your computer. This should fix all connectivity problems, but does mean AltStore may not be able to automatically refresh apps for you in the background over Wi-Fi.
If you can't find the answer to your question here, you can email [email protected], and we will try to get back to you as soon as we can.
What if I need to use the Windows Store version of iCloud?
AltStore requires that you install iCloud directly from Apple in order to authenticate your Apple ID. If you need to use the Windows Store version instead, you can follow these alternate instructions copied from this reddit post:
- Download and install iTunes from the official Apple website. Make sure to scroll down and click on "Windows" next to the "Looking for other versions?" text.
- Download and install iCloud from the official Apple website. Make sure to scroll down and click on the link in this text: "* On Windows 7 and Windows 8, you can download iCloud for Windows on Apple's website".
- Locate your "C:\Program Files (x86)\Common Files\Apple" folder. Copy the "Apple Application Support" and "Internet Services" folders, then create a new folder, name it anyway you want, and paste them in.
- Remove iCloud from your computer. DO NOT remove iTunes! (Also, NEVER remove the "Apple Mobile Device Support" or the "Apple Application Support" that are installed alongside iTunes and iCloud.)
- Install iCloud from the Windows Store.
- Download and install AltServer. When you open it for the first time, click on "Choose Folder...", and locate the folder you created in the 3rd step.